Stark Law Blanket Waivers – What is a COVID-19 Purpose?

Posted on April 27, 2020 by
Blog

The Blanket Waivers that the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services issued under the Stark Law apply only to financial relationships and referrals that are related to the national emergency that is the COVID-19 outbreak in the United States.
